Output 2673868dc2c2b03799e11ed6f52a221adabd0ce06f2d8a5ee16f40a61bfb37c8:1

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c645c70b30a132c1885d31bd9b06717dcf48f540 OP_EQUALVERIFY OP_CHECKSIG
address
1K5NPD8Vs5ULPrPhSrJB84zmnwaP8VHqx7
transaction
2673868dc2c2b03799e11ed6f52a221adabd0ce06f2d8a5ee16f40a61bfb37c8
spent
true